    Abstract: A knit cleaning pad for cleaning a surface, such as a flooring surface, is provided that is formed with a knitted construction having a holding stitch disposed between adjacent stitched layers. The holding stitch enables the pad to maintain its shape without any significant stretching or pulling to the original shape of the pad. The knitted construction also enables the pad to be used in a reversible manner and to be secured directly to the head of a suitable cleaning device without the need for any additional securing mechanisms.

    Abstract: An automatic weaving process for the manufacture of rope hammock beds in which a bobbin of rope passes through loops of rope from the same bobbin resulting in a traditional weave (FIG. 1) from one continuous rope. The process and machine create a woven, open mesh pattern of rope or like materials for forming articles, such as hammocks. The means comprise a frame having a plural set of opposed reciprocal rods, each having a pulley-shaped or like structure mounted on their opposing ends. The frame also supports a means for attaching one end of the rope, and a set ofpulleys to each side centrally, but laterally movable to the rods.
